Cost to Own a Home in Freeport, Texas

A $119,000 home here costs

$1,101

per month, all in — with 20% down at today's 6.66% 30-year fixed rate.

A standard mortgage calculator would have told you $612. The real number is $490 higher every month — 80% more than the payment most buyers budget for.

Where every dollar goes

Only the first line is a mortgage payment. Change any assumption above and every figure below recalculates.

Principal & interest30-year fixed, $95,200 borrowed $612
Property tax0.967% effective rate for Freeport itself $96
Homeowners insuranceTexas averages $2,124/yr (NAIC), or 0.794% of home value $79
Electricity16.44¢/kWh — Texas residential average, EIA $148
Water, sewer & trashUS household average $68
Maintenance reserve1% of home value per year $99
Total monthly $1,101

The weather behind that power bill

Freeport sits in Brazoria County, which averages a high of 91.6°F in its hottest month and a low of 46.8°F in its coldest, with 53.37" of precipitation a year and 31% of it in a single three-month stretch. That climate drives 3,213 cooling and 1,044 heating degree days, which is what sets the $148 electricity line above.

Common questions

How much does it cost to own a home in Freeport?

A $119,000 home in Freeport, Texas costs approximately $1,101 per month with 20% down at 6.66%. That is $612 principal and interest, $96 property tax, $79 homeowners insurance, $216 utilities and $99 set aside for maintenance.

What is the property tax rate in Freeport?

Freeport has an effective property tax rate of 0.967%, based on a median home value of $118,900 and median real estate taxes of $1,150. That is lower than the Brazoria County average of 1.745%.

What is the average home price in Freeport?

The median owner-occupied home value in Freeport, Texas is $118,900, against $276,800 across Brazoria County.

Is it cheaper to rent or buy in Freeport?

Median gross rent in Freeport is $1,061 a month, against $1,101 to own the median home all in. Renting costs less month to month here, though renting builds no equity.

Sources & methodology

  • Median home value, real estate taxes, gross rent and population for Freeport — US Census Bureau, American Community Survey ACS 2023 5-Year, place-level tables.
  • Homeowners insurance — NAIC average premium for Texas.
  • Electricity price — EIA Electric Power Monthly Table 5.6.A.
  • Mortgage rate — Freddie Mac PMMS, refreshed weekly.
  • Maintenance (1%/yr) and water and sewer ($68/mo) are national estimates. Every assumption above is editable.
